Metzger 0912005 Switch, reverse light

Overview

The Metzger 0912005 Switch, reverse light is a precision-engineered component designed to provide reliable illumination for vehicle rear‑view operations. It serves as the electrical interface that activates the reverse lighting system when the driver engages the gearshift into reverse. This switch ensures safe maneuvering in low‑visibility conditions by illuminating the vehicle’s rear and warning nearby pedestrians or cyclists.

Design & Build

The unit features a compact, rugged housing crafted from high‑strength polymer that resists impact, vibration, and temperature extremes typical of automotive environments. Its sleek profile allows seamless integration into existing dash panels without requiring extensive modifications. The switch is sealed to protect against moisture, dust, and debris, guaranteeing long‑term performance even in harsh climates.

Functionality

When the gearshift is moved into reverse, the Metzger 0912005 Switch closes its internal contacts, completing the circuit that powers the vehicle’s rear illumination. The switch operates on standard automotive voltage (typically 12 V DC) and is engineered to handle current loads up to 10 A, ensuring compatibility with most reverse light assemblies.

Usage Tips

  • Always verify that the switch is properly seated in its housing before reconnecting power.
  • Check for any loose or frayed wiring connections; secure them with electrical tape or heat shrink tubing to prevent shorts.
  • When troubleshooting reverse light issues, test the switch with a multimeter to confirm continuity when engaged.
